The first Princé of Persia gamé was a fántasy cinematic platform titIe released in 1989. It was désigned by Jordan Méchner for the AppIe II and pubIished by Broderbund. Set in anciént Persia, the unnaméd prince must vénture through a séries of dungeons tó defeat the Gránd Vizier to savé an imprisoned princéss. In 2003, Ubisoft began to develop and publish the series with the release of Prince of Persia: The Sands of Time. The last originaI game in thé franchise so fár has been 2010s Prince of Persia: The Forgotten Sands, which was released for PlayStation 3, PlayStation Portable, Wii, Xbox 360, Nintendo DS, and Microsoft Windows.
